#1f6e28 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f6e28 is composed of 12.2% red, 43.1%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 71.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.6%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 126.8 degrees, a saturation of 56% and a lightness of 27.6%. #1f6e28 color hex could be obtained by blending #3edc50 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#1f6e28 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1f6e28 has RGB values of R:31, G:110,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.72, M:0, Y:0.64, K:0.57. Its decimal value is 2059816.

Shades and Tints of #1f6e28
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010301 is the darkest color, while #f3fbf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f6e28
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#454845 is the less saturated color, while #048913 is the most saturated one.
